Training a child is the commandment of God. God instructed the parents to train up their children in the way they should go. When the child grows up, he will continue in the things which he or she had learned. The Bible has instructions on how we should train our children. We are to expose the children to the things which they are to learn about life. When these children are well informed about life right from their tender age, they will grow without going into depression.

Philippians 4:6-7 (KJV) Be careful for nothing; but in every thing by prayer and supplication with thanksgiving let your requests be made known unto God.
And the peace of God, which passeth all understanding, shall keep your hearts and minds through Christ Jesus.

Children are the heritage of the Lord. They are the fruits of the womb. They are the rewards from God. As God's heritage, we are to show those children the ways of God. We should teach them on the proper ways of living their lives to please God. They need to learn those things that are basic training that are capable of making a person to have a reasonable life. It is the way we train our children that will guide them as they are growing. A person who has already understand what is happening in the world and is exposed to the challenges of life will know how to manage his or herself from the various situations that he or she will meet.
